Job Description

Your Team

The Development Coordinator is a critical position within the Land Team. They are responsible for a broad variety of tasks including, but not limited to contract administration, construction administration, coordinating with the City and utility companies along with coordinating with other internal Brookfield departments.  The top priority is keeping all parties accountable. 

Your Key Deliverables

Project Administration

Understand required documents for projects to include contracts, NTPs, permits, inspection results, and acceptance

Maintain (update and archive) required documents for each project; coordinate with consultants and land team members to keep accurate

Assist in all aspects of the Final Platting process and related documentation through recording, segregation, and addressing

Assist managers, directors, and VPs with project trackers

Attend consultant meetings as requested

Continue to organize files in Land folder on the server

External Customer Coordination

Establish populate, and communicate data rooms for land sales, lot substantial completion, and visitor inquiries

Assist managers, directors, and VPs with presentations

Assist in the acquisition and/or relinquishment of any new assets or easements as required

Assist in the preparation of consultant contracts

Assist PMs in tracking contract timelines for important dates (i.e. substantial completion, deposits, fees, etc)

Financial Reporting

Understand LandDev software be available to troubleshoot and correct problems on payday; analyze budgets

Create invoices for fees assessed to others

Participate in the procurement, acceptance, monitoring, and release of all project bonds

Maintain bond tracker; consistently review it and make sure land team is on schedule; reconcile quarterly with accounting’s bond list

Collect and sort MUD required documents

Assist with Bond Application Reports collection annually

Miscellaneous

Create and maintain contact lists for projects to include consultants, contractors, and internal team members

Create and maintain contact lists for external groups to include partner builder sales, marketing, land, and superintendent teams

Coordinate the procurement of materials and services required for internal team
